Goldman Sachs, founded in 1869 by Marcus Goldman and later joined by Samuel Sachs, is a premier global investment bank headquartered in New York City, renowned for its influential role in financial markets. The firm provides a wide range of services, including investment banking (mergers, acquisitions, and underwriting), securities trading, asset management, and consumer banking through its Marcus platform, catering to corporations, governments, institutions, and high-net-worth individuals. Known for its elite status on Wall Street, Goldman Sachs has a history of navigating major economic events, from the Great Depression to the 2008 financial crisis, where it played a controversial yet pivotal role. With a strong emphasis on innovation and a global footprint, it manages billions in assets and remains a powerhouse in shaping economic policy and market trends.

Goldman Sachs's Q1 2024 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2024, Goldman Sachs held 6,050 positions worth $564B, up 4% from $543B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 19% of the portfolio.

Goldman Sachs withdrew a net $23.2B in Q1 2024, closing 529 positions and reducing 2,527 holdings. Its most notable exit was Cooper Companies, an estimated $173M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 17% of assets, up from 17%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Consumer Discretionary.

Against the trend, Goldman Sachs opened a new position in State Street SPDR Portfolio Long Term Treasury ETF worth $195M.
